    Alsu Khamidovna Kurmasheva (Russian: Алсу Хамидовна Курмашева, Tatar: Алсу Хәмид кызы Кормашева, romanized: Alsu Xämid qızı Qormaşeva; born () September 1, 1976) [1] is a Russian and American journalist with Radio Free Europe/Radio Liberty's Tatar-Bashkir Service.

    Evan Almighty is a 2007 American fantasy comedy film [3] that is a spin-off and sequel of Bruce Almighty (2003). The film was directed by Tom Shadyac, written by Steve Oedekerk, based on the characters created by Steve Koren and Mark O'Keefe from the original film.

    The longest word whose letters are in alphabetical order is the eight-letter Aegilops, a grass genus. However, this is arguably a proper noun. There are several six-letter English words with their letters in alphabetical order, including abhors, almost, begins, biopsy, chimps and chintz. [31]
